In this method, tensor indices are directly given by group elements with no direct use of the character expansion. We apply the tensor renormalization group method to this tensor network for $SU(2)$ and $SU(3)$, and find that the free energy density and the energy density are accurately evaluated. We also show that the singular value decomposition of a tensor has a group theoretic structure and can be associated with the character expansion.","authors_text":"Daisuke Kadoh, Masafumi Fukuma, Nobuyuki Matsumoto","cross_cats":["hep-th"],"headline":"","license":"http://creativecommons.org/licenses/by/4.0/","primary_cat":"hep-lat","submitted_at":"2021-07-29T16:15:39Z","title":"Tensor network approach to 2D Yang-Mills theories"},"references":{"count":0,"internal_anchors":0,"resolved_work":0,"sample":[],"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"source":{"id":"2107.14149","kind":"arxiv","version":1},"verdict":{"created_at":null,"id":null,"model_set":{},"one_line_summary":"","pipeline_version":null,"pith_extraction_headline":"","strongest_claim":"","weakest_assumption":""}},"verdict_id":null}}],"author_attestations":[],"timestamp_anchors":[],"storage_attestations":[],"citation_signatures":[],"replication_records":[],"corrections":[],"mirror_hints":[],"record_created":{"event_id":"sha256:306d5a9f7104ed55d1acd2e69bdfe638a1fa5994f48f034245a499a57a432302","target":"record","created_at":"2026-07-05T03:01:44Z","signer":{"key_id":"pith-v1-2026-05","public_key_fingerprint":"8d4b5ee74e4693bcd1df2446408b0d54","signer_id":"pith.science","signer_type":"pith_registry"},"payload":{"attestation_state":"computed","canonical_record":{"metadata":{"abstract_canon_sha256":"a6f9db4083d0649860a3bfbffe339c1f0062cd7b487f4854e35f587c1ca1b8f1","cross_cats_sorted":["hep-th"],"license":"http://creativecommons.org/licenses/by/4.0/","primary_cat":"hep-lat","submitted_at":"2021-07-29T16:15:39Z","title_canon_sha256":"eabfab1528dea50bf81db00190a9d6679019a172f57a857b0d9acdc1585526af"},"schema_version":"1.0","source":{"id":"2107.14149","kind":"arxiv","version":1}},"canonical_sha256":"ce2b9c1f75bf627a1d87135cb31aa26082d698f6604d6542c641839c83c1e84c","receipt":{"algorithm":"ed25519","builder_version":"pith-number-builder-2026-05-17-v1","canonical_sha256":"ce2b9c1f75bf627a1d87135cb31aa26082d698f6604d6542c641839c83c1e84c","first_computed_at":"2026-07-05T03:01:44.908600Z","key_id":"pith-v1-2026-05","kind":"pith_receipt","last_reissued_at":"2026-07-05T03:01:44.908600Z","public_key_fingerprint":"8d4b5ee74e4693bcd1df2446408b0d54","receipt_version":"0.3","signature_b64":"zqMzcrH6lNKkyqZp4C4oJccGzCgZpziDMs2yNL8veAtWRaDRexQvbwTHUwm2EpbNRTjo6S6vD0lnPM4abcrsCA==","signature_status":"signed_v1","signed_at":"2026-07-05T03:01:44.908960Z","signed_message":"canonical_sha256_bytes"},"source_id":"2107.14149","source_kind":"arxiv","source_version":1}}},"equivocations":[],"invalid_events":[],"applied_event_ids":["sha256:306d5a9f7104ed55d1acd2e69bdfe638a1fa5994f48f034245a499a57a432302","sha256:22fe92b5a1cab9d5625f31d8dbe242027121b5399af67915123120909a23039f"],"state_sha256":"7879c3ab6d71afe33b469cfc94fae7eb287aa875aafc8db0b59d729f3726ce0a"},"bundle_signature":{"signature_status":"signed_v1","algorithm":"ed25519","key_id":"pith-v1-2026-05","public_key_fingerprint":"8d4b5ee74e4693bcd1df2446408b0d54","signature_b64":"9KHqonAhCiU+iHR3xMcYQiRGJYM4e4oG6p92TImyTVdopdGyxGLkpEjGGrEVzJS77AHdn1EUAlyCOefqK2aIBw==","signed_message":"bundle_sha256_bytes","signed_at":"2026-08-10T20:03:47.302318Z","bundle_sha256":"fc2aa94591ae752638a2ba8e11fd00663863d94f47817e37298e934ea0e7c43c"}}
